With the arrival of Vim9 classes, the syntax must allow for
_new_ constructors; multiple constructor definitions are
supported for a class, provided distinct suffix-names are
used. Currently, the defined constructors match either
vimCommand or vimFunctionError (for any newBar).
For example:
------------------------------------------------------------
vim9script
class Foo
def new()
enddef
def newBar()
enddef
endclass
------------------------------------------------------------
Since every constructor is required to bear a lower-cased
_new_ prefix name, it should suffice to distinguish them
from functions, and so there are no new highlight or syntax
groups introduced.
